This has actually happened twice to me. Once on Tales of the Abyss (that was quite some time ago) and Tales of Destiny Director's cut. When I got to random spots in the game there were "imaginary walls" to further explain I couldn't move past a certain spot even though it was where I was supposed to go.

I couldn't find anything else about this, but does anyone know of a way to fix these problems?
If you're sure you're meant to progress past these walls, then oftentimes the game needs a different EE or VU rounding mode.
